           Laurie began her creative life at the age of three with tap dancing.  She then proceeded to add playing the violin, piano, and bass to her creativity.  While attending Penn State, studying theatre arts with a dance emphasis, Laurie took art classes which touched her soul.  After graduating from Penn State, Laurie attended CCA (California College of Arts) and received a degree in design.  She then worked in the graphic design business in the Bay Area for several years.  For the past 20 years she has made a living as a recording artist/musician/bass player/singer-songwriter.  Laurie has five CDs currently published, and at night after her gigs she creates her artwork.

            Laurie’s award winning artwork has shown in both group and solo gallery exhibitions and events.  Laurie has sold several pieces of her artwork, especially limited edition giclee prints of her ‘Plant People’ painting.  Laurie is also a member of the Women in Arts.

            Laurie enjoys painting in several styles.  Currently she is focusing on her modern expressionism, surrealistic, abstract, and nature series.  Her surrealistic style is created with watercolors, acrylics, and pastels.  Sometimes she uses the technique of removing masking fluid randomly placed to add movement and energy to her pieces.  Her artistic influences are Salvador Dali and Marc Chagall.
